RideKC Freedom in Johnson County is a curb-to-curb, shared ride public transportation service for Johnson County residents whose disability or condition prevents them from using regular bus or micro transit services.
Key Features of this Service Include:
- Rides are shared and may include other passengers with different destinations
- Drivers and vehicles vary—and so can travel time and routing
- Pick-up windows are generally 30 minutes, not exact appointment times
- Drivers do not enter buildings or provide personal care assistance
- Riders must be able to navigate the service, recognize their vehicle, and communicate their needs independently or with their own personal assistant
- Communicate basic needs
- Identify or respond to their vehicle when it arrives
- Navigate to/from the curb safely
- Remain stable and safe during shared, indirect rides
If the rider cannot safely or independently manage these conditions, they may require a Personal Care Attendant (PCA).
